Mixing Valve (Fig. 21)
• As the stem moves downward:
—
Flow from port B to AB decreases linearly.
—
Flow from port A to AB increases at an equal per-
centage rate.
• As the valve stem moves upward:
—
Flow from port B to AB increases.
—
Flow from port A to AB decreases.
NOTE:
The B port seat of the VGF3_EM valves is con-
structed as a cage, not as a seat, and moves
through the B port. It does not offer tight close-
off. For leakage specifications, see Table 4. B port
flow is at a minimum when stem travel down is
3/4 in. (20 mm) in 2-1/2 and 3 in. mixing valves.
OUTDOOR RESET CONTROL (FIG. 24)
• Connect the A port to a boiler output.
• Connect the B port to the system return.
AIR HANDLING APPLICATIONS (FIG. 23)
• Connect the A port to the output of a coil.
• Connect the B port to the coil bypass.
BOILER/CHILLER BYPASS (FIG. 25)
• VGF mixing valves are not recommended for boiler or
chiller bypass due to B port close-off ratings. Use
diverting model instead.
IMPORTANT
VGF Mixing Valves are assembled through the
lower (B) port. The B port stop collar (see Fig. 21)
holds the stem and plug assembly in the bonnet.
Ensure the stem remains raised while servicing
the valve or installing stem extensions. The stem
collar provides a hard stop for direct-acting
MP953 pneumatic actuators, and should not be
removed.
Note that the full stroke of the valve stem can be greater
than the control stroke dimension, Y, in Table 8, which is
measured from the closure of the A port. Honeywell
actuators are constructed for this Y dimension, and limit
stem travel appropriately.
DIVERTING VALVE (FIG. 22)
• As the valve stem moves downward:
—
Flow from port AB to A decreases linearly.
—
Flow from port AB to B increases linearly.
• As the valve stem moves upward:
—
Flow from port AB to A decreases.
—
Flow from port AB to B increases.
OUTDOOR RESET CONTROL (FIG. 25)
• Connect the A port to the building supply.
• Connect the B port to the boiler return.
AIR HANDLING APPLICATIONS (FIG. 26)
• Connect the A port to the coil supply.
• Connect the B port to the system return.
NOTE:
The A and B connections may be reversed when
using pneumatic actuators.
